摘要
In this paper, we review the behavior of suppliers with different level of rationality. The problem of how to bring electricity market a potential behavior risk is investigated using behavior game theory. First, a behavior automata network model is developed on the condition that the rationality is taken as a variable. Then, a class of learning rules, such as Cournot and extended Cournot adjustment is discussed, which are different behavior variable values. The results of evolutionary experiments indicate that the variables may bring a great diversity of prediction to the market, which means that the market may face a potential risk coming from the rationality of the power suppliers. Therefore, it is important to reduce the diversity by introducing an anti market power. An artificial elasticity method is proposed then for this reason. As an improvement of price cap strateogy, the method introduces an artificial elasticity to the oligopolistic competition market and it also induces the suppliers to change their behavior of high bidding, The results of evolutionary experiments show that the method and model are effective.
